golden053This anthology which I co-edited with Christopher Golden and James A Moore is shipping now.  It’s a collection of all new horror stories from British writers, both established and relatively new to the field.  And we happen to think it’s very good indeed.

Cemetery Dance report that BRITISH INVASION, the anthology I co-edited wgolden051ith Christopher Golden and James A Moore, is on the way!  Click the link above to see full contents, and just take a look at this fantastic artwork by the very excellent Les Edwards.  If you’re a contributor … you’ll be getting your copy soon.  If you’re not, you really should invest in this.  It’s an excellent collection, even if I do say so myself (and in fact, other people say so too … see below):

“From Gord Rollo’s transcendentally eerie tale of a comatose young boy’s revenge to Mark Morris’s cautionary tale about a pair of unorthodox vampires, the 21 original stories in this anthology establish the strength of British horror writers.” – Library Journal
